No. 18 Tar Heels open season against Orange in ACC matchup


UNC football coach hasn’t tried to dismiss the high expectations that are following his 18th-ranked Tar Heels entering Saturday’s season-opening visit from Syracuse. The Tar Heels closed last season with three straight blowout wins. And they’re picked to be a factor in an ACC race. Brown said it’s now time to prove that hype is deserved. (Associated Press)
